Every year, approximat­ely 6.5 million companion animals enter shelters nationwide, according to the American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als. Of those, about 3.3 million are dogs and 3.2 million are cats.

An adorable bundle of wrinkles

An absolute potato of a puppy, Tamale is sure to be everyone’s favorite bundle of wrinkles! The 16-week-old American pit

Bull Terrier mix not only has the sweetest dispositio­n, she also has the sweetest expression that is sure to let her get her way with anything she wants!

Tamale and her litter were rescued by an Arizona Humane Society Emergency Animal Medical Technician in early May after they were found as stray puppies wandering the streets of Phoenix. Noted to have diarrhea, AHS tested them for parvo and luckily found they were negative; however, Tamale did have a bit of a puppy cold that needed treatment.

After about a month in a loving Foster Hero home receiving medical treatment and learning the ins and outs of the good life off of the streets, Tamale is now in search of her forever home. Those who know this cute pup say she is loving and playful!

How to adopt: As the Arizona Humane Society continues to struggle with capacity issues throughout its shelter, AHS is offering a “Choose Your Adoption Fee” special for all dogs, including puppies, through July 4. When adopting from AHS, you are not only saving the life of that pet but creating much-needed kennel space for the shelter to continue bringing in and saving even more sick, injured and abused pets.

Interested adopters can meet the tremendous Tamale at the Arizona Humane Society’s PetSmart Scottsdale location. Her adoption fee includes her spay surgery, current vaccinatio­ns, a microchip, and a follow-up wellness exam with a VCA Animal Hospital
